Indian-origin DJ Jailed in UK for Trying to Defraud Health Services of 837,000 Pounds - (04 Jun 2018)

Sandip Singh Atwal, known as Sunny, was filmed dancing and working as a courier after claiming that negligent treatment he received from the UK's state-funded National Health Service (NHS) for minor injuries had left him unemployed and dependent. The 33-year-old was found in contempt of court on 14 counts at a hearing in April and was sentenced at the UK High Court on Friday.
